Tality released a high-performance medium access controller (MAC) for IEE 802.11 wireless local area network baseband chips. It consists of a synthesizable MAC core and protocol stack. The core is available in three configurations: a dual-mode IEEE 802.11a/b design using two ARM7TDMI processors; a similar design using a single ARM9 processor; and an IEEE 802.11b (Wi-Fi) design using a single ARM7TDMI. The core and protocol stack were co-developed as an optimized and integrated system. The modular architecture enables rapid modification to conform to evolutions in the IEEE 802.11 specification. The system is designed for maximum data throughput with minimum processor load and chip power consumption. The MAC executes all datapath functions, leaving the host processor to manage and control the protocol at an abstracted level. The IEEE 802.11a/b MAC core and its pre-designed baseband configurations are available now for integration into chip designs.
